The Denver Nuggets (33-16) will host the Portland Trail Blazers (15-33) after victories in five straight home games. It begins at 9:00 PM ET on Friday, February 2, 2024.

The Nuggets take the court as double-digit favorites against the Trail Blazers. The Nuggets are favored by 11.5 points. The game’s point total is set at 223.

  • Denver has come away with 31 wins in the 43 contests it has been listed as the favorite this season.
  • Denver has yet to lose in three games when named as at least a -759 moneyline favorite.
  • Denver has an implied victory probability of 88.4% according to the moneyline set by oddsmakers for this matchup.
  • Portland has put together a 14-30 record in games it was listed as the moneyline underdog (winning 31.8% of those games).
  • Portland has not yet won a game when they entered play as a moneyline underdog with odds of +513 or longer in nine chances.
  • Based on this matchup’s moneyline, Portland has an implied win probability of 16.3%.
  • The Nuggets average 114.7 points per game, only two fewer points than the 116.7 the Trail Blazers allow.
  • When Denver totals more than 116.7 points, it is 14-8-1 against the spread and 18-5 overall.
  • Portland is 14-6 against the spread and 10-10 overall when it scores more than 110.8 points.
  • Denver’s record is 13-10 against the spread and 20-3 overall when it allows fewer than 108.5 points.
  • The Nuggets are at the 17th spot in the NBA’s scoring charts (114.7 PPG), while the Trail Blazers allow the 18th-fewest points per game (116.7) in the league.
  • The 29th-ranked scoring NBA team (108.5 PPG) is Portland, while the Denver squad ranks fourth in the league defensively (110.8 PPG).
  • The Nuggets have out-scored their opponents by a total of 193 points this season (3.9 points per game on average), and opponents of the Trail Blazers have out-scored them by 392 more points on the year (8.2 per game).
  • The average implied total for Denver this season is 117.3 points, 0.3 more points than its implied total of 117 points in Friday’s game.
  • So far this season, Denver has put up more than 117 points in a game 23 times.
  • Portland’s average implied point total on the season (118 points) is 12 points higher than its implied total in this matchup (106 points).
